The FreedomTruespeed Group (FTG), which reflects the recent merger between alternative broadband networks Freedom Fibre and Truespeed (here), has today announced that customers of Truespeed’s retail ISP can now order broadband packages over FF’s original full fibre (FTTP) network in the North West and Midlands of England.

Just to recap. The current group is the product of several prior network mergers. The combined alternative Fibre-to-the-Premises (FTTP) broadband network of both operators is said to cover a total footprint of 419,000 UK premises (RFS) across the North West, West Midlands, South West and East of England, while connecting over 73,000 customers. But until now the two networks haven’t yet been physically integrated together for Truespeed’s retail customers to access (network integration is a long and complex process).

NOTE: The FreedomTruespeed Group is backed by investment partners Aviva Investors, InfraBridge, and Equitix. The merger saw Freedom Fibre continue as the group’s wholesale network, working with its established partners, while Truespeed and LilaConnect remain as customer-facing retail ISP brands.

Over the past few months the newly created group has been busy working to integrate their systems, processes and teams, which also included a customer migration onto one system stack. The good news is that this phase of the integration has largely completed, so they’ve now moved on to tackle the physical network.

As such today’s news extends Truespeed’s customer propositions into Freedom Fibre’s wholesale network in the North West and West Midlands regions for the first time (i.e. customers can now order broadband packages in part of Freedom Fibre’s network area), which “marks completion of the first phase of integration with Freedom Fibre, delivered just three months after the merger closed in May“.

Nathan Vautier, CEO of Freedom Truespeed Group, said:

“Three months ago, we set out to prove that Freedom Truespeed Group could quickly bring two complementary businesses together while maintaining trading momentum, delivering efficiencies and realising commercial benefit by opening the combined network footprint with cross-brand access. Today’s launch is the first tangible milestone in that plan, delivered on schedule and to the standard of disciplined execution our customers, partners and investors expect as we continue to scale.”

Further Retail, Wholesale and Network integration milestones are expected to follow in phases over the coming months. Prices typically start at £20 per month for speeds of 150Mbps on an 18-month term and rise to £29 for 900Mbps.

Freedom Fibre continues to operate its wholesale network platform in partnership with providers including PXC, Zen Internet and a range of retail ISPs alongside in-house FTG retail brands, Truespeed and LilaConnect.
